2007 Oil Consumption Issues?

13116 Views 12 Replies 9 Participants Last post by  Welshb
So, I'm looking to buy a TC, 2007, around 90,000 miles. I've already seen the car and driven it, and I'm having my mechanic inspect it soon. Now, while I was looking at common problems with the TC, I found that excessive oil consumption is a common issue, especially on the 2007 models. From what I've heard, the problem usually surfaces at around 110,000 miles, and it can cost thousands of dollars to repair.

So have you or other TC owners you know encountered this issue on a 2007 car? I want to get an idea of how common this problem is.

I have a 2007 Tc. The engine was removed from my car by the dealer to correct the engine oil consumption. Prior to the rebuild, the oil needed refill every month. After the rebuild, the oil remains until I have it changed as recommended by the manufacturer. Torrence CA wrote me to take it in to a dealer to run a test on it to find out whether or not my Scion was one with the consumption problem, the oil was tapped until the parts were received and I did not have to pay one cent except aggravation with the dealer left a bolt 3 or 4 inches out of the transmission, returned car with a 6 mos old battery dead and now i want to know when the dealer had the engine out, should the motor mounts have been inspected and if faulty should I have been informed?
